The Driveway Assistance Device (DAD) solves a longstanding work zone dilemma: How to control residential driveways that fall within a one-lane bidirectional workzone.

Since 2011, Horizon Signal has worked exclusively with various state Departments of Transportation to develop the DAD as an effective method for controlling driveway traffic. Each DAD is equipped with two flashing arrows to inform the motorists as to the direction traffic is flowing through the work zone. Drivers may enter the queue in the direction of the flashing arrow, thus reducing the likelihood of wrong-way driving within the lane closure.

As part of the signal system network, each DAD has full conflict monitoring capabilities. The DADs also have the capability to be activated and deactivated sequentially in order to maximize safety within the signal setup.

How It Works

The Horizon SIgnal Driveway Assistance Device (DAD) is designed to address residential driveways that fall within a one-lane bi-directional work zone.  The DAD displays a flashing arrow in the direction traffic is flowing on the mainline.  Motorists exiting their driveway may join or follow the queue in the direction of the flashing arrow. A solid red indication is displayed when it is unsafe to enter the work zone.

Each DAD, as part of the signal system, is linked wirelessly to create a network. Flash indications end sequentially as traffic moves through the zone, helping to reduce the likelihood of drivers entering the work zone near the end of the cycle.

REDUCES LIKELIHOOD OF WRONG WAY DRIVING
LED arrow indications inform the motorist as to the direction of traffic flow.

CONTROL AN UNLIMITED NUMBER OF DRIVEWAYS
One DAD is placed at each residential driveway within the work zone, with the ability to control an unlimited number of driveways.

SEQUENTIAL FLASHING OPERATION
The ability to operate DADs sequentially enhances overall safety.

FORM FACTORS
The DAD is available in multiple platforms to meet specific project requirements

SAFETY
Each DAD has full conflict monitoring capabilities featuring Horizon's dual processor MMS.

MAXIMIZES WORK ZONE TRAFFIC FLOW
All driveways are serviced each cycle without requiring additional red clearance time, thus keeping cycle times to a minimum.
